The WSDL document http://localhost:8080/xxxx/xxx.wsdl could not be read

最近有个需求要学webservice,需要用给出的wsdl生成webservice类,用的是myeclipse,生成之前会有一个“WSDL Validation” 的检查,报错“The WSDL document http://localhost:8080/xxxx/xxx.wsdl could not be read”。


原因是我的wsdl的源采用的是本地工程的wsdl,那么实际在验证的时候就会去访问这个url,而此时我的工程还没有部署到tomcat上去,访问这个URl自然是读取不到wsdl文件。

正确的做法是:

把工程部署到tomcat上,然后启动tomcat,然后再根据url源的wsdl来创建webservice。



版权声明:本文为libertine1993原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。